Product Review

Helps students by describing skills and attributes that are valuable in the workplace, answering common questions, delivering expert advice that is relevant in today's hiring market, and showcasing high-quality resumes and cover letters prepared by professional resume writers—all written for college students or new graduates. It is a comprehensive resource appropriate for diverse college majors, both undergraduate and graduate, as well as for students seeking internships and co-op jobs while still in school.

Key Features

* A large collection of more than 100 top-notch sample resumes written by professional resume writers and career counselors, targeted to help college students and graduates at all levels land the job they want.
* Internet job search and resume help.
* Self-evaluation worksheets to help readers discover their skills and adapt their college experience to the real world.
* Guidance on writing all types of job search correspondence, such as cover letters, thank-you notes, job acceptance letters, and job declination letters.

I'd actually picked up this book at my local Borders when it was still around. One of the best purchases I've made when it comes to my career. As a recent grad, I was looking for some updated information about resumes and cover letters.

The structure of the book is:

1. Proving your value to employers - The author asks you to clearly define what job target you are seeking and also gives you some examples. Soft and Hard skills are explained here, which is helpful.

2. Writing your Resume - In a step by step manner, the author guides you through writing a good resume. More examples are weaved in to give you some ideas.

3 .Managing your Job Search - on and off - The Internet is now a primary place to look for jobs, so it's wise to have a strong online profile. The author explains how to post and convert your resume online.
